Senior Business Analyst - Web Projects

Working for one of Australia's most recognised and loved brand name organisations which has a genuine commitment to their employees, their growth has been extensive and exponential. They are now looking for a Senior BA who will assist in their ever expanding online journey.

For this role, you should have experience in online projects, mobile app based projects or a background as a BA in the retail industry. You will definitely be an expert in the online world (preferably online retailing) and will be fully across the need to construct high quality user experience. You may come from another retail organisation, large corporate strongly geared towards online business or even a start-up in the online area.

For the right person we are able to secure sponsorship to enable you and your family to live and work in Australia. So, if you are overseas, fit the role well and looking for a refreshing change in sunny Australia then please get in touch.

The responsibilities of the role include;

  • Definition of new functionality in order to deliver business solutions
  • Participating in business planning, needs analysis and risk assessment
  • Working with business and technology teams to lead/drive the definition, elicitation, prioritisation and validation of business requirements and design of business processes to meet the needs of the organisation
  • Effective engagement of business partners, project stakeholders ensuring that the recommended solution is aligned to the targeted business outcomes, justifying the solution
  • Planning, estimating and reporting on Business Analysis activities and deliverables
To succeed in this role you will have:
  • Highly developed analytical and problem solving skills with a high degree of initiative and flexibility
  • A minimum 3 years experience in a Senior Business Analyst role, within a large organisation
  • Solid experience in workshop facilitation, negotiation and influencing key project stakeholders to derive business needs
  • Demonstrable ability to elicit, analyse, develop and manage business requirements, relate these to business processes, and ensure alignment with Corporate and Technology strategies
  • Proficiency in evaluating information gathered from multiple sources, identifying and resolving conflicts
  • Evidence to show how you contribute to and lead projects that meet business strategy needs and deliver improvements in practices
Other skills that will be highly regarded are:
  • Experience in an Agile or hybrid Agile environment
  • Retail Experience, preferable in a multi-brand organisation
  • Proficient experience in BPM and process improvement
  • IIBA or ESI Certification; or equivalent; or working towards same
